When you look at replacing your HVAC system, several variables shape the final bill. The size of your home and the specific ductwork required play a major role in labor time. Then there is the efficiency rating of the unit itself; higher-rated systems cost more upfront but often lower monthly utility bills. You also have to consider the brand, the type of fuel source, and whether you need to upgrade electrical components to handle the new equipment.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
The price for a mini-split system is driven by the capacity of the outdoor unit and the number of wall-mounted heads you need installed. Factors like wall material, mounting accessibility, and the distance between indoor and outdoor components influence the final labor. AC installation in Nashua involves selecting the appropriate cooling unit size based on your home's square footage and insulation. Licensed, insured pros will assess your existing ductwork or recommend ductless mini-split systems for targeted cooling. They ensure proper refrigerant charging and system testing for optimal performance. A professional installation guarantees efficiency and longevity for your new air conditioning system.
